Is cyberbullying a crime? While there is currently no federal law in the US that explicitly prevents cyberbullying by name, all states outlaw bullying, and most include a reference to the online variety as well. Additionally, many forms of cyberbullying fall under other illegal categories, such...

In most cases, where cyberbullying laws exist, the crime is a misdemeanor with a maximum term of imprisonment of not more than two years. Of course, the bullying can escalate to a more serious crime, in which case, a more serious penalty may apply. Because the offenders are often minors...
